As per the Salesforce Global Digital Skills Index, India has the highest digital-ready score (63 out of 100) among 19 nations. In India, 72% of those polled claim they are actively pursuing technology capabilities to plan for the futureof business.

Sixty-six percent of those surveyed in India indicated they are well-equipped to develop digital skills. The Index is collected through a survey of over 23,500 employees from 19 nations, with a global preparedness score of 33 out of 100 as the average.
